리눅스 명령 연습

1. / guanli에 두 개의 디렉토리가 zonghe 만들고 jishu (명령) / guanli 디렉토리를 생성

[루트 @ localhost를 ~] #에서 mkdir -p / guanli / zonghe | MKDIR / guanli / jishu

2, 2001, 2002에 그룹 계정 zonghe, caiwu이 jishu가, GID 번호가 설정되어 추가

[루트 @ localhost를 ~] # groupadd -g 2001 zonghe
[루트 @ localhost를 ~] # groupadd -g 2002 caiwu
[루트 @ localhost를 ~] # groupadd -g 2003 jishu

3. 기린 사용자 계정이 2020 12월 30일 후에 만료 제리, 기린, tsengia, 오바마 사용자를 만듭니다

[루트 @ localhost를 ~] # useradd와 제리
[루트 @ localhost를 ~] # useradd와 기린
[루트 @ localhost를 ~] # useradd와 tsengia
[루트 @ localhost를 ~] # useradd와 오바마
[루트 @ localhost를 ~] # usermod에 -e 2020-12- 30 기린

제리, 기린, tsengia 추가 4 그룹으로 오바 다른 사용자 zonghe

[루트 @ localhost를 ~] # gpasswd 명령어 -M 제리, 기린, tsengia, 오바마 zonghe

5, 편리한 생성, 쉘 로그인 cucci 계정이 "경우 / sbin / nologin으로"로 설정되어, 사용자 cucci

[루트 @ localhost를 ~] # 편리 useradd와
# useradd와의 cucci [~ 루트 @ 로컬 호스트]를
[루트 @ localhost를 ~] # usermod에 -s / sbin에 / nologin으로 cucci

그룹 jishu에 편리한, cucci 다른 사용자를 추가하는 6,

[루트 @ localhost를 ~] # gpasswd 명령어 -M 편리한, cucci jishu

도 7은 모든 사용자 guanli 내의 상기 그룹에 추가 할 필요

[루트 @ localhost를 ~] # groupadd guanli
[루트 @ localhost를 ~] # gpasswd 명령어 -M 제리, 기린, tsengia, 오바마, 편리한, cucci guanli

8, 오바마 사용자가 zonghe 그룹에서 삭제
[루트 @ 로컬 호스트는 ~] # gpasswd 명령어 -d 오바마 zonghe는
"zonghe"그룹에서 사용자 "오바마"삭제하다

9 제리 (통상의 방법을 이용하여) "123456"인 사용자의 패스워드 설정
cucci 사용자에게 (메소드 --stdin 옵션을 사용하여) "레드햇"암호를 설정하는
[루트 @ 로컬 호스트 ~] # passwd에 제리
사용자 암호 제리 변화.
새 암호 :
잘못된 비밀번호 : 비밀번호를 8 자 미만
재 입력 새 암호를 :
passwd에 모든 인증 토큰이 성공적으로 업데이트되었습니다.

[루트 @ 로컬 호스트는 ~] # 에코 passwd를 --stdin 옵션을 cucci | "레드햇"
사용자의 암호 cucci을 변경합니다.
passwd에 모든 인증 토큰이 성공적으로 업데이트되었습니다.

도 10에서, 사용자는 제리 잠그고 잠금 상태를 확인하는

[루트 @ localhost를 ~] # passwd를 제리 -l
제리 사용자의 암호를 잠금.
passwd 파일 : 작업 성공
[루트 @ localhost를 ~] # passwd에 -S 제리
제리 2019년 7월 30일 LK -1 0 99999 (7) (. 암호가 잠겨 있습니다)

11 개의 연결 상태를 확인 (사람 또는 w) 명령에 의해 오픈 윈도우를 xshell, 상기 퓨저 명 내지

[루트 @ 로컬 호스트 ~] # w
9시 43분 14초 최대 29 분, 3 사용자 부하 평균 : 0.00, 0.03, 0.07
로그인 @ 유휴 JCPU PCPU FROM USER TTY 무엇
루트 PTS / 1 192.168.100.186 9시 43분 4.00s 0.04 의 0.04s -bash
루트 점 / 0 192.168.100.186 9시 36분 2.00s 0.07s 0.01sw
[루트 @ localhost를가 ~] # 퓨저 -k / dev에 /가 / 1 점
/ dev에 / / 1 점 : 3585을

12 cucci 사용자가 해당 그룹에 속하는보고, 세부 정보를 봅니다

[루트 @ localhost를 ~] # 그룹 cucci
cucci : cucci jishu guanli
[루트 @ localhost를 ~] # 손가락 cucci의
로그인 : cucci 이름 :
디렉토리 : / 홈 / cucci 쉘 : 경우 / sbin / nologin으로
로그인하지 마십시오.
없음 메일.
어떤 계획이 없습니다.

13 수동으로 계정 학생을 만듭니다


14 세트의 권한과 소유권 :
/ guanli 디렉토리 그룹 설정 guanli는
Zonghe에 그룹 / guanli / zonghe 디렉토리입니다
/ guanli / 디렉토리는 그룹 jishu 세트 jishu이
세 개의 디렉토리가 다른 사용자 액세스 권한을 금지 설정

[루트 @ localhost를 ~] #에 대한 Chown : guanli / guanli
[루트 @ localhost를 ~] # LL -d / guanli
drwxr-XR-X를. (4) 루트 7月30 17시 14분 33 guanli / guanli

[루트 @ localhost를 ~] #에 대한 Chown : Zonghe / Guanli [/ Zonghe
. [루트 @ localhost를 ~] #에 대한 Chown :. 저널 / Guanli [/ 저널

[루트 @ localhost를 ~] # 게요 / guanli
总用量0
drwxr-XR-X. 2 루트 jishu 6 7月30 17시 14분 jishu의
drwxr-XR-X. 이 루트 zonghe 6 7月30 17시 14분 zonghe

[루트 @ 로컬 호스트 ~] # 개는 chmod -R 720 / guanli
[루트 @ 로컬 호스트 ~] # LL / guanli
总用量0
---- ¹ 록 drwx-w 2 루트 jishu 6 7月30 17시 14분 jishu의
¹ 록 drwx-w ----. 2 루트 zonghe 6 7月30 17시 14분 zonghe
[루트 @ 로컬 호스트 ~] # LL -d / guanli
---- ¹ 록 drwx-w (4) 루트 7月30 17시 14분 33 guanli / guanli

15 일 공개 디렉토리를 설정 / ceshi
기술 그룹의 모든 사용자가 파일을 실행, 쓰기 읽을 수 있도록
읽기, 쓰기, 다른 사용자를 금지, 실행

[루트 @ localhost를 ~] #에서 mkdir / ceshi
[루트 @ localhost를 ~] #에 대한 Chown : jishu / ceshi
[루트 @ localhost를 ~] # LL / ceshi
用量0总
[루트 @ localhost를 ~] # LL -d / ceshi
drwxr-XR -엑스. 2 루트 jishu 6 7月31 10시 27분 / ceshi
[루트 @ 로컬 호스트 ~] # chmod를 770 / ceshi
[루트 @ 로컬 호스트 ~] # LL -d / ceshi
drwxrwx ---. 2 루트 jishu 6 7月31 10:27 / ceshi

16 사용자 암호 제리을 취소

[루트 @ localhost를 ~] # passwd를이 -d 제리는
사용자의 암호 제리을 취소합니다.
passwd 파일 : 성공적인 운영

17 사용자의 암호 잠금 및 상태 cucci를보기

[루트 @ localhost를 ~] # 용의 passwd -l의 cucci
잠겨 cucci 사용자의 암호를 입력합니다.
passwd에 : 작업 성공
[루트 @ 로컬 호스트 ~] #에 CUCCI Passwd 파일 -S
. CUCCI LK 2019년 7월 30일 99999 0-1 7 (. 암호가 잠겨)

18, 사용자의 UID가 수정 오바마 8888

[루트 @ localhost를 ~] # 8888 오바마 기능 usermod -u
[루트 @ localhost를 ~] # 꼬리 / 등 /를 passwd에
를 Avahi에 대한 : X : 70 : 70 :를 Avahi mDNS를 /는 DNS-는 SD 스택의 경우 : / var / RUN / 위해를 Avahi - 데몬 : / sbin에 / nologin으로
후위 : X : 89 : 89 :은 / var / 스풀 / 후위 : 경우 / sbin / nologin으로
싶으면 tcpdump : X : 72 : 72 :: / : / sbin에 / nologin으로의
FISH : X : 1000 : 1000 : FISH : / 홈 / FISH : / 빈 / bash는
제리 : X 축 : 1001 : 1001 :: / 홈 / 제리 : / 빈 / bash는
기린 : X 축 : 1002 : 1002 :: / 홈 / 기린 / 빈 / bash는
tsengia : X 축 : 1003 : 1003 :: / 홈 / tsengia : / 빈 / bash는
오바마 : X 축 : 8888 : 1004 :: / 홈 / 오바마 : / 빈 / bash는
핸디 : X 축 : 1005 : 1005 :: / 홈 / 핸디 : / 빈 / bash는
CUCCI : X 축 : 1006 : 1006 :: / 홈 / CUCCI : 경우 / sbin / nologi
(19), 기린 passwd 명령 60 일까지 기간을 사용하여 사용자의 암호를 수정

[루트 @ 로컬 호스트는 ~] # passwd를은 60 기린 -x
사용자 암호 노화 데이터 기린의를.
passwd 파일 : 성공적인 운영
[루트 @ localhost를 ~] # 꼬리의 / etc / 그림자
기린 : !! : 18107 : 0 : 60 :. 18626 : 7 :

(20), 사용자 ID 정보 경편 기 핑거 명령을 확인

[루트 @ localhost를 ~] # ID가 편리
UID = 1005 (편리한) GID = 1005 (편리한)组= 1005 (편리), 2003 (jishu), 2004 년 (guanli)
[루트 @ localhost를 ~] # 그룹 편리
편리 : 편리한 jishu guanli
[루트 @ localhost를 ~] # 손가락 편리
로그인 : 편리 이름 :
디렉토리 : / 홈 / 편리한 쉘 : / 빈 / bash는
. 로그인 기록 없음
없음 메일.
어떤 계획이 없습니다.

추천

출처www.cnblogs.com/canflyfish/p/11275191.html